Get a $100 LinkedIn ad credit and launch your first campaign at [LinkedIn.com/TFS](! --------------------------------------------------------------- 🎧 New podcast episode: [Legendary Investor John Doerr on Picking Winners — From Google in 1999 to Solving the Climate Crisis Now]() John Doerr ([@johndoerr]()) is an engineer, venture capitalist, the chair of Kleiner Perkins, and the author of the #1 New York Times bestseller [Measure What Matters](=). His new book is [Speed and Scale: An Action Plan for Solving Our Climate Crisis Now](. John was an original investor and board member at Google and Amazon, helping to create more than half a million jobs. A pioneer of Silicon Valley’s cleantech movement, John has invested in zero-emission technologies since 2006. He’s passionate about encouraging leaders to reimagine the future, from transforming healthcare to advancing applications of machine learning. Outside Kleiner Perkins, John works with social entrepreneurs who are tackling systemic issues across climate, public health, and education. Please enjoy!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
